All posts

The simplest way to make Avro Azure Storage work like it should

The moment your team starts piping Avro data into Azure Storage, you either gain a predictable data workflow or drown in mismatched formats and permission errors. You can spot the difference instantly. In one case, ingestion logs hum quietly. In the other, containers choke on incorrect schema files and your ops channel fills with sighs. Avro gives structure to serialization. Azure Storage keeps that structure safe but distributed. Together they form the backbone of modern cloud data handling, i

Free White Paper

Azure RBAC + End-to-End Encryption: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

The moment your team starts piping Avro data into Azure Storage, you either gain a predictable data workflow or drown in mismatched formats and permission errors. You can spot the difference instantly. In one case, ingestion logs hum quietly. In the other, containers choke on incorrect schema files and your ops channel fills with sighs.

Avro gives structure to serialization. Azure Storage keeps that structure safe but distributed. Together they form the backbone of modern cloud data handling, if—and this is a big if—you line up identity and schema enforcement properly. When done right, the pairing means your pipeline can ship billions of rows without breaking a sweat or losing track of who owns what.

How Avro and Azure Storage actually work together

Avro defines how your data looks in transit and at rest. Schema evolution lets new fields coexist with old records, so ingestion doesn’t need version gates. Azure Blob Storage acts as your durable layer to hold those serialized containers, indexed and replicated across accounts. The real trick comes with mapping organizational identity: assigning access through Azure Active Directory roles and enforcing least privilege at the blob level.

Teams often forget that the smartest data architecture fails if permissions lag behind. Use RBAC to bind dataset access tightly to group identity, not tokens pasted into code. Rotate secrets using managed identities or Key Vault along your deployment pipeline. This keeps Avro schemas flowing while keeping auditors calm.

Common setup questions

How do I connect Avro pipelines to Azure Storage easily?
Serialize your data with Avro on ingestion, output to your blob container, and let Azure Data Factory or Synapse trigger ingestion based on schema metadata. This separation of schema and storage simplifies data movement and versioning across environments.

Continue reading? Get the full guide.

Azure RBAC + End-to-End Encryption: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Best practices for stable data handling

  • Keep one canonical Avro schema registry per environment.
  • Automate blob cleanup using lifecycle rules.
  • Use managed identities for writer services.
  • Monitor schema mismatches with simple checksum reports.
  • Prefer schema evolution over static formats when adding fields.

Developer velocity and daily workflow

For developers, Avro Azure Storage integration means fewer security approval cycles and simpler CI/CD pipelines. You push data, not credentials. Debugging happens with consistent schema context, reducing human friction between devs, ops, and compliance. Your code stays focused on logic rather than storage quirks.

Platforms like hoop.dev turn those identity rules into guardrails that hold automatically. The system enforces access while your applications keep moving. You define policy once, hoop.dev applies it everywhere, protecting endpoints across environments without extra YAML gymnastics.

AI implications

As teams add copilots and agent-driven automation to their stacks, Avro Azure Storage becomes an easy vector for accidental data leakage. Keeping schemas tightly defined minimizes unapproved model training on sensitive fields. AI can help verify schema usage, but it cannot replace proper RBAC mapping. Machines should learn from clean data, not from permission errors.

Benefits snapshot

  • Faster onboarding for new data services
  • Reliable access control across workloads
  • Self-documenting data format through Avro schema
  • Predictable lifecycle management inside Azure Storage
  • Lower operational toil when rotating credentials

Wrap-up

Avro and Azure Storage form a sturdy bridge between controllable schema and durable cloud storage. Build the connection with identity as your foundation and automation as your guardrail. Once that’s done, your data pipeline runs smooth, silent, and secure.

See an Environment Agnostic Identity-Aware Proxy in action with hoop.dev. Deploy it, connect your identity provider, and watch it protect your endpoints everywhere—live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ts